Charles De Gaulle once said, “I have come to the conclusion that politics is too serious a matter to be left to the politicians.”

Thus, RealPolitics and the RealPolitics Podcast exist.

This is a place for political discussion of all kinds — whether you’re liberal, conservative, libertarian, socialist, or anywhere in between, all opinions are welcome here.

The name “RealPolitics” is derived from the German term realpolitik, meaning “practical politics.” We like talking about actual solutions to political problems, big and small, from local government all the way to international relations. Our podcast covers politics through that lens, exploring the nuances of US and international politics with the guidance of our rotating panel of young analysts and commentators.
